  3. It doesn't look to be isolated to specific factions, as I have the doubled static charges on my sin, but not my shadow. From what I've tested, the bug seems to be related to removal of active stances and adding them to the discipline trees instead. Basically, they gave us the new passive versions and forgot to remove the effects of the previously active stance. So it's doubling up on the effect of the stance (ie, double armor for tanks, surging charge/shadow technique stacks building twice as fast, etc.), and it's actually something I've noticed on other classes as well (like 6% instead of 3% passive alacrity from Ataru form for Combat/Carnage, doubled Rage refund from Shien form for Jugg/Guardian). It also looks like respec'ing removes any duplicated effects, reverting them back to their intended form (respec'ing my shadow from tank to dps (and vice versa) and swapping from combat to watchman (and back again) removed any bugged effects, that I could tell). My guess is they'll force a discipline reset for all characters to fix this issue, at least in the short term. Enjoy your increased dps/mitigation while it lasts!

  5. I just wanted to outline a few issues I have noticed since the release of the Outfit Designer. (Not quite sure if Bug Reports is really the right place for it, so hopefully this doesn't get flagged/deleted.) 1) If a Character's appearance is set to show the currently equipped gear (aka no Costume), the dye module is not applied in the character selection screen. (Dye mods seem to be displaying properly for applied costume appearances.) 2) The preview window doesn't display the currently equipped weapon(s) if a costume appearance is applied. In more detail: in order to preview a color crystal, one would have to either a) apply the currently equipped gear's appearance or b) also preview a weapon alongside the color crystal. In other words, the preview window only shows the equipped weapon(s) if the currently equipped gear appearance is applied. So, effectively, color crystal previewing is broken, unless you preview a weapon at the same time. 3) The Costume Designer welcome/tutorial notification resets upon logout, and thus reappears/pops up upon character sheet entry (once per character session). None of these are particularly game-breaking, however they are rather annoying to encounter on a reoccurring basis (number 3 especially...).
